Tom aged 7 1/2 years requires support workers to join his small care team. He is a loving, sweet and cheeky chap who has cerebral palsy and additional medical needs. We are looking to recruit calm, engaging and experienced support workers to join Toms’ team. The team work closely with the parents who are instrumental in their son’s care.

The role involves supporting Tom with his therapeutic programs through fun activities and to support his learning and assisting with water based activities including hydrotherapy. Also with daily tasks such as personal care and assisting with providing his home prepared diet and medication via his feeding tube.

This job will suit a confident and reliable candidate who has flexibility to fit into the team and support the family with the care hours required and to accompany Tom and his family on holiday.

Training will be provided for all aspects of Tom’s care and mandatory health and safety training.
